Questions to Ask Your Future Self

Questions to ask your future self are reflection prompts you write down now and answer, or revisit, later — in a letter, a journal, or a note you open in a year. They help you track growth, clarify goals, and see how much can change.

Hopes and goals

  • What do you hope you've accomplished by now?
  • Did you reach the goal that mattered most to you this year?
  • What's something you were working toward — did it happen?

Growth and change

  • What are you proud of that you couldn't do before?
  • What fear did you finally face?
  • What habit did you build or break?
  • Who has become important to you since I wrote this?

Values and priorities

  • Are you still spending time on what actually matters to you?
  • What would you tell me, your past self, right now?
  • Is there anything you'd do differently?

Everyday life

  • Where are you living, and who are you closest to?
  • What's making you happy these days?
  • What's a small joy you almost forgot to notice?

Looking ahead

  • What do you want the next version of you to focus on?
  • What are you grateful for right now?

How to use them: write a letter to your future self and set a date to open it — one year is popular, but six months or five years works too. Answer honestly, date it, and store it somewhere you'll find it. When the day comes, read your old answers first, then respond to each question again and compare. It's a simple habit that makes growth visible.

Frequently Asked Questions

What questions should I ask my future self?

Ask about the goals you're working toward, fears you want to face, habits you hope to change, what you're grateful for, and what you'd tell your past self. Mix ambitious goals with everyday reflections.

How do you write a letter to your future self?

Write down your current thoughts, hopes, and questions, set a date to open it (a year is popular), answer honestly, and store it somewhere you'll find it. Revisit it on the date and answer the questions again.

Why ask your future self questions?

It makes growth visible. By writing questions now and answering them later, you can see how your goals, habits, and priorities have shifted, which helps you reflect and set new intentions.
